    Uticaj sorte i načina proređivanja plodova na prinos i krupnoću jabuke (Malus domestica Borkh.)

    Get PDF
    The aim of the research was to use in the conditions of Cacak, using a preparation for fruiting: naphthyl acetic acid amide (NAD), naphthyl ̶ 1 ac acetic acid (NAA), benzyladenine (BA) and manual thinning, on three varieties of apples: Red Chief , Golden Reinders and Gloster examine their method of yield per tree (kg), yield per unit area (t ha1) and fruit mass (g). The results showed that the differences in terms of all three parameters among the tested varieties were significant and the differences between the applied treatments were also significant.     Evaluation of innovative and environmentally safe growing practice suitable for sustainable management of plum orchards

    Get PDF
    Intensive agricultural development based on the long-term and excessive use of chemical nitrogen fertilizers significantly contributes to a series of undesirable effects and results in environmental pollution. In line with the above, there is a pressing need for major changes in agricultural production management. Bearing in mind that fertilization strategy, among other practices, plays an important role in improving the growing technology of different fruit crops, we considered that the above mentioned problems could be overcome by introducing an environmentally safe and innovative practice inplum growing technology as well. Accordingly, a comparative study was conducted to evaluate the effects of biofertilizer (a combination of nitrogen-fixing and phosphorus-mineralizing bacteria including Azotobacter chroococcum, Bacillus megatherium and Bacillus subtilis) and chemical fertilizer (a water-soluble chemical fertilizer supplemented with the microelements B, Cu, Fe, Mn and Zn)on ʻČačanska Lepotica' and 'Stanley' plum cultivars. Morphometric characteristics (fruit weight, length and width), internal quality traits (soluble solids content and firmness) and chemical properties (total phenolic content and total antioxidant activity) of the fruit of the tested plum cultivars were assessed. The obtained results indicate that the substitution of chemical fertilization with biofertilization in 'Čačanska Lepotica' and 'Stanley' is a justified practice.
